This study deals with the subject of (Stimulus to Paradise
in the Statement of the Prophet), and depend on the
selected texts of: (Al-Albany book: Sahih Al-Jamie AlSaqir), the study starts from the statement of the concept
Stimulus (Hafz) and that give willies to the soul and push
it to get to a particular command, and that Paradise is the
greatest obtain, and the magnificent aim to be stimulated
to and encouraged therefore Prophet, peace be upon him,
concerned with stimulating the target audience, and
suspense them to the heavens, and push them to do the
good of words and actions leading to it, the study aims to
identify the positions of stimulus to bliss in his words,
peace be upon him, and the statement of the means of
sensual and moral stimulation, and stand place to show
the rhetoric of the Prophet, and the study of his methods
may Allah bless him and in this section, and the disclosure
of secrets in stimulation the nation toward paradise.
The study relied on the descriptive and analytical
approach which means contemplation of texts and study
it and reveal its eloquent in words and meaning, the study
came into a preface three chapters and a conclusion, the
preface deals with examples of the Prophet's, peace be
upon him, eloquence in the eyes of scholars, and looking
into the meaning of (stimulation) in the language and
terminology, and a summary of Sahih Al-Jamie Al-Saqir
and its author Al-Albain, my God forgive him, and the
first chapter is of two sections, the first is about, work and
reward on it by paradise in the context of faith, legislation
and transactions, while the second section deal with those
texts where work is related to reward and credentials to
provide one over the other, and the second chapter and
composed of two sections, the first dealing with
immediate sensory stimulation (in the current life) and the
day after, and the second deals with the moral means of
stimulation in this life and the day after, the third chapter
is combined of two sections which gather some of the
syntax and morphology in the stimulating prophetic texts.
The research has reached a number of conclusions, the
most important: that the stimulus prophetic embodiment
of the human soul and the need to encourage and
stimulate a while, and that the correlation between
reward and paradise in all contexts favored by God to
improve one's, and rise in all aspects of life, and that the
texts of stimulation comes into two categories: One
related to describing paradise and bliss, and the work and
the promise of the Paradise coupled without elaborating,
and when work meet the reward the progress of work
always dominated, and this is in the contexts of legislation
and acts of worship in particular, this is subject to many of
the verbal and moral justifications as well as the Prophetic
stimulation has sate both aspects of sensory and emotional
of the soul, and did not omits human spur toward
immediate bliss in this world, and the most important
results that describe the eloquence of the Prophetic
stimulation, and its appearance in the completed
statement, the excellent logic and a fuller meaning,
including what the Prophet, peace be upon him, has used
out of nice syntax and brilliant morphology, which are
revealed by the miracle of his words, and is characterized
by linguistics and eloquence. |
